Ange Postecoglou never got to work with Jeremie Frimpong at Celtic but the Australian was full of praise for the former Hoops right back ahead of his Parkhead return on Thursday.
“He has done really well,” Postecoglou told the Glasgow Times. “He did well here in the couple of years and I think he would be the first to say his time with Celtic helped him in his career.

“We gave him that platform on which to perform. He did so and he got a great move after it.
“Anyone who passes through this club is part of our history and I am sure he would acknowledge that.”
Jeremie will return to Celtic Park with Bayer Leverkusen in the Europa League and will play an almost unrecognisable side from the one he left in January.
Celtic could not turn down the money on offer for the German club back in the winter window but they’ve taken a long time to replace Jeremie.
It’s only been in the last month Josip Juranovic has come in to help out Anthony Ralston who was thrown into the limelight this season. To be fair to Ralston, he’s played well and has shown a lot of people he’s much more than just a fringe player.
